Do you really want feedback? Personally I guess I could say I've seen worse...??? Why is every wire seen not concealed, Your electronics sources...you did all that work to drive those electronics and speakers...PLEASE tell me you plan on changing those! You have manual switching devices as a band-aid...Nice touch (sarcasm!). I do like the lighting. One (other) thing I would do is put some fiber-optics in the ceiling. Lutron all the lights so you have remote control on all the lights. There's my feedback. You also NEED!!! a nice audio cabinet. Target, Lovan...anything but that lovely oak cabinet.
